Personal data Hendrik Westijn 


Household of Hendrik Westijn

He is married to Maria van der Gaag.

They got married on May 9, 1829 at Naaldwijk, Westland (ZH), he was 25 years old.Source 3


Child(ren):

  1. Barbara Westein  1830-1865 
  2. Maartje Wesstein  1832-1901
